Decoding Personalized Medicine’s Future with AI

The human body is a complex ecosystem teeming with trillions of microorganisms – bacteria, fungi, and more are collectively known as the microbiome. The microscopic community plays a crucial role in health and disease, and scientists are now harnessing the power of Artificial Intelligence (AI) in Decoding Personalized Medicine’s Future.

AI: Cracking the Microbiome Code

  • Unveiling Hidden Patterns: AI algorithms can analyze vast amounts of microbiome data, identifying subtle patterns and correlations that might elude human researchers. This allows for a deeper understanding of how the microbiome influences health and disease.
  • Personalized Risk Prediction: By analyzing an individual’s microbiome alongside other health data like genetics and lifestyle factors, AI can predict their risk for certain diseases with greater accuracy. This paves the way for preventative measures and early intervention.
  • Targeted Treatment Strategies: AI can help identify specific bacterial strains or imbalances in the gut microbiome associated with specific diseases. This knowledge can be used to develop personalized treatment plans, such as targeted probiotics or prebiotics to restore balance.
  • Optimizing Drug Discovery: AI can analyze vast libraries of microbial data to identify potential drug targets within the microbiome. This can accelerate the discovery of new medications with fewer side effects, tailored to individual needs.

The Future of Artificial Intelligence and the Microbiome

The field of AI-powered microbiome research is still young, but its potential for revolutionizing personalized medicine is immense.

As research continues, we can expect even more sophisticated AI tools to be developed, leading to:

  • Microbiome-based diagnostics: Non-invasive tests that analyze the microbiome for early disease detection.
  • Microbiome engineering: Techniques to manipulate the microbiome composition for therapeutic purposes.
  • AI-powered microbiome apps: User-friendly applications that provide personalized dietary and lifestyle recommendations based on an individual’s unique microbiome.
